🧬 Which concepts form the foundation of mathematics?

Basic maths covers arithmetic, fractions, decimals, percentages, and an introduction to shapes.

  • Arithmetic refers to add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division of whole numbers.
  • Decimals and fractions describe quantities smaller than one or between integers.
  • A percentage shows a value as a portion out of one hundred.
  • Shape recognition and measurement are the first steps in geometry.

These topics build on each other, so mastering one makes the next easier to learn.

⚡ What are the essential operations in maths?

The four fundamentals of maths are add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division.

  • Addition combines two or more values to find a total or sum.
  • Subtracting tells you what remains after you remove a quantity.
  • Multiplying shows how much you get when you have several equal groups.
  • Division splits a number into equal parts or finds how many times one fits into another.

These four operations underpin algebra, geometry, and every advanced maths topic.
